Agricultural sprayers are essential tools for modern farming, offering precision in applying fertilizers, pesticides, herbicides, and other chemicals to crops. These sprayers help increase yield, reduce waste, and protect crops from harmful pests and diseases. However, selecting the right agricultural sprayer for your farm can be a daunting task due to the variety of types, features, and specifications available.

In this guide, we will walk you through the key factors to consider when choosing the right agricultural sprayer for your farm. Whether you're a small-scale organic farmer or managing large commercial fields, selecting the right sprayer can greatly impact your farm's productivity, cost efficiency, and crop health.


Understanding the Different Types of Agricultural Sprayers

Before you start shopping for an agricultural sprayer, it’s important to understand the different types available and how they are used.

1. Boom Sprayers

Boom sprayers are large-scale sprayers commonly used in fields with large, flat surfaces. They feature a boom or set of arms that extend across the width of the field to spray chemicals evenly.

  • Best for: Large farms and commercial operations.

  • Key benefits: Efficient for wide coverage, reducing application time and labor.

  • Considerations: Suitable for flat fields; may not be effective in orchards or hilly areas.

2. Backpack Sprayers

Backpack sprayers are smaller, portable sprayers carried on the back of the operator. They are typically used for smaller areas or for targeted spraying tasks.

  • Best for: Small farms, gardens, orchards, or spot treatments.

  • Key benefits: Highly portable, easy to use, and suitable for hard-to-reach areas.

  • Considerations: Limited capacity compared to larger sprayers, not ideal for large-scale applications.

3. Self-Propelled Sprayers

These sprayers are designed for large-scale applications and come with built-in wheels and an engine, allowing them to move across the field on their own. They are especially useful for uneven or large areas.

  • Best for: Large commercial farms with a focus on efficiency and speed.

  • Key benefits: Can cover a large area quickly, allowing for fast application of chemicals.

  • Considerations: Expensive and requires maintenance; not ideal for small farms.

4. Airblast Sprayers

Airblast sprayers use high-powered air streams to disperse chemicals, making them ideal for orchards and vineyards. These sprayers have a high air velocity that helps ensure even coverage, especially on trees with dense foliage.

  • Best for: Orchards, vineyards, and areas with dense vegetation.

  • Key benefits: Effective for targeting trees, vines, and high canopy crops.

  • Considerations: Not ideal for row crops or large, flat fields.

5. Tow-Behind Sprayers

These sprayers are towed behind a tractor or other farming vehicle. They are typically larger than backpack sprayers but are more portable than boom sprayers. Tow-behind sprayers are ideal for fields with moderate sizes.

  • Best for: Medium-sized farms with diverse crops.

  • Key benefits: Versatile, can cover large areas without the need for a large self-propelled sprayer.

  • Considerations: Requires a tractor or other towing equipment.


Key Factors to Consider When Choosing an Agricultural Sprayer

Now that you understand the types of agricultural sprayers, it's essential to consider several key factors when making your choice.

1. Farm Size

The size of your farm plays a critical role in determining the type of sprayer that will work best for your needs.

  • Small Farms (under 5 acres): For smaller operations, backpack sprayers or tow-behind sprayers may be sufficient. These options are portable, cost-effective, and ideal for spot treatments and smaller plots.

  • Medium-Sized Farms (5-50 acres): For medium-sized farms, boom sprayers or tow-behind sprayers can cover a larger area quickly, providing a balance of coverage and cost.

  • Large Farms (over 50 acres): For large-scale farms, self-propelled sprayers or large boom sprayers are typically the most efficient. These sprayers allow for quick application over extensive areas, reducing labor and time.

2. Crop Type

Different crops may require different types of sprayers for optimal coverage.

  • Field Crops: For row crops like corn, wheat, or soybeans, boom sprayers are generally the best choice. They can efficiently cover wide rows with uniform distribution of chemicals.

  • Orchards and Vineyards: Airblast sprayers are ideal for these types of crops, as they can provide targeted spraying to trees and vines, ensuring that the chemicals penetrate the foliage properly.

  • Vegetables and Greenhouses: Backpack sprayers or smaller boom sprayers are often more practical for smaller and more confined spaces like greenhouses or vegetable fields.

3. Sprayer Capacity

The capacity of the sprayer's tank will directly affect how often you need to refill it during application.

  • Large Tanks: A larger tank will allow you to cover more area before needing to refill, making it more efficient for large farms.

  • Smaller Tanks: Smaller tanks are lighter and more manageable, but they will require more frequent refilling, making them better suited for small to medium operations.

4. Application Method

The method by which the chemicals are applied is an important consideration. Depending on your farm’s needs, you might require a sprayer with specific features.

  • Manual vs. Automatic: Some sprayers come with automatic settings for pressure and spray rate, while others require manual adjustments. For larger farms or commercial operations, automatic systems can save time and labor by ensuring consistent application.

  • Adjustable Nozzles: Some sprayers come with adjustable nozzles that allow you to change the spray pattern and pressure, providing greater flexibility depending on your crop type and application requirements.

5. Terrain and Field Type

The type of terrain your farm occupies can influence which sprayer will be most effective.

  • Flat Fields: For large, flat fields, boom sprayers or self-propelled sprayers are generally the best option for covering large areas quickly.

  • Hilly or Uneven Terrain: In uneven terrain, a sprayer with excellent maneuverability, such as a self-propelled sprayer or a tow-behind sprayer, can help navigate obstacles and ensure consistent coverage.

6. Budget

Agricultural sprayers come in a wide range of prices, depending on their features and capabilities. It’s essential to choose a sprayer that fits your budget while also meeting the specific needs of your farm.

  • Entry-Level Sprayers: Backpack sprayers and small tow-behind sprayers are generally more affordable, making them suitable for small-scale operations or those just starting out.

  • High-End Sprayers: For larger farms or those with more complex needs, self-propelled sprayers and large boom sprayers may be more expensive, but they offer enhanced capabilities and efficiency.


Maintaining Your Agricultural Sprayer

Proper maintenance is essential to ensure that your agricultural sprayer remains in good working condition and provides consistent, reliable performance. Here are some tips for maintaining your sprayer:

  • Regular Cleaning: Clean your sprayer after each use to prevent chemical buildup and clogging. This is especially important for sprayers used with fertilizers or pesticides.

  • Inspecting Nozzles and Filters: Regularly check and clean the nozzles and filters to ensure even spraying. Clogged nozzles can lead to uneven application, affecting crop health.

  • Check for Leaks: Always check for any leaks in the tank, hoses, or connections. Leaks can waste chemicals and reduce the efficiency of your sprayer.

  • Store Properly: Store your sprayer in a dry, safe place when not in use, and make sure it is properly drained to prevent chemical residue from causing damage.

FAQ

Q: How often should I clean my agricultural sprayer?
A: It’s recommended to clean your sprayer after each use to prevent clogging and ensure effective operation. Clean thoroughly, especially after using chemicals like fertilizers or pesticides.

Q: Can I use the same sprayer for both pesticides and fertilizers?
A: While it's possible to use the same sprayer, it's important to clean it thoroughly between uses to prevent cross-contamination and ensure proper chemical application.

Q: What size sprayer do I need for a 10-acre farm?
A: For a 10-acre farm, a boom sprayer or tow-behind sprayer with a tank capacity of 50-100 gallons would likely be sufficient for efficient coverage.
